WORK AND WAGES
! FREE AMBULANCE RESTORES “CUT” j < Press Association!. | WELLINGTON, May 21. ' J The Wellington Free Ambulance ; Board has decided to restore the ro- j maitiing 5 per cent, salary cut retrospective to April 1. 'The question of a 44-hour week is also occupying the attention o! the board. A report of the superiiiteii--1 dent shows that three additional men j -woiild be required. The matter was t left in abeyance in the meantime.
